The Clarence Valley Orchestra and Chorus are back again with An Afternoon at The Pops for their 10th Anniversary at the Saraton Theatre with another fantastic program from Artistic Director & Conductor Greg Butcher on Sunday afternoon 27th October.Their 10th anniversary concert special guest artists are The Kransky Sisters from Esk, who are driving their Morris down to Grafton to join the Clarence Valley Orchestra & Chorus for the performance. The Kransky Sisters have been regular guests on television including SBSs In Siberia Tonight and ABCs The Side Show, Spicks and Specks and BBCs Comedy Shuffle.Venturing out from the secret laden walls of the sisters secluded home, this strange and endearing trio will share stories of their misfit adventures paired with famous songs gleaned from the old wireless at home. From Abba to Daft Punk, Sia to Steppenwolf, Pink to Pink Floyd, get ready to hear well-known tunes like youve never heard them before! With their peculiar spin on popular songs played on an eclectic mix of instruments including musical saw, tuba, old reed keyboard, and kitchen pots, these oddball Queensland Sisters are looking forward to bringing to the table their own tunes while sharing the Saraton Theatre stage with the popular local orchestra & chorus.The Clarence Valley Orchestra has become the musical flagship of the Clarence Valley, promoting classical music and popular entertainment on a grand scale for the pleasure of both our community and visitors to the area.
